Kipp Van Camp, D.O. Named Chief Operating Officer for Global Stem Cells Group

Global Stem Cells Group announces the appointment of Kipp Van Camp, D.O., Chief Operating Officer. Van Camp, a former family practitioner and interventional radiologist, was a GSCG advisory board member for years

MIAMI (PRWEB) DECEMBER 08, 2015

Global Stem Cells Group has announced the appointment of Kipp Van Camp, D.O. to the position of Chief Operating Officer for the international biotech company. Van Kamp is an interventional radiologist and former family practitioner with a medical career spanning 25 years.

According to Global Stem Cells Group CEO Benito Novas, Van Camp’ distinct background in medicine, entrepreneurial ventures and corporate management makes him the obvious choice to spearhead a new era of growth for the company.

As COO, Van Camp will take over direct management of GSCG’s day-to-day operations, and make managerial decisions.

Van Camp is the author of “Misdiagnosis: A Practicing Physician’s Case Study of Health Care Reform,” and hosts the popular “Doctor’s Orders” radio show. A native of western Kansas, he is triple board certified in family medicine and radiology, Van Camp co-owns radiology practices in Kansas City and Topeka, Kansas, and is the owner and Medical Director of Rejuvenate Medical Spa in Topeka, where he administers minimally invasive cosmetic treatments.

He serves as an adjunct professor at Washburn University and the University of Kansas. He also engages in clinical and scientific medical research, and serves as the Medical Director of Precise Clinical Research.

For four years, Van Camp served as a member of the Global Stem Cells Group advisory board, and is well acquainted with the company’s mission to bring the latest stem cell therapies to patients worldwide.

“We are very happy to have an esteemed professional like Dr. Van Camp to fill the position of Global Stem Cells Group’s chief operating officer,” Novas says. “He possesses the knowledge, experience, and commitment to the potential of stem cell technology that is necessary to fill this position, which makes him a critical addition to the team, one who will ensure we are well positioned into the future.”

About Kipp Van Camp, D.O.

An interventional radiologist and former family practitioner, Kipp Van Camp, D.O. (“Dr. Kipp”) is triple board certified in family medicine and radiology. A native of western Kansas, he earned a doctor of osteopathic medicine degree (D.O.) from Kansas City University of Medicine and Biosciences in 1990.

Van Camp is the author of “Misdiagnosis: A Practicing Physician’s Case Study of Health Care Reform,” and hosts the popular“Doctor’s Orders” radio show. He served on the Global Stem Cells Group advisory board for four years.

His formal education includes medical training with two residencies and a fellowship covering a span of nine years of post-graduate education. He began his medical career practicing family medicine in rural northwest Missouri, performing a variety of duties, including delivering babies, pediatrics and elder care. After completing his residency in diagnostic radiology at Oklahoma State University in Tulsa, Van Camp received a fellowship in interventional radiology at Washington Hospital Center in Washington, DC.

His passion for medicine and an entrepreneurial spirit led him to pursue and establish a variety of health-centric ventures. He co-owned radiology practices in Kansas City, Missouri and Topeka, Kansas, and was owner and medical director of Rejuvenate Medical Spa in Topeka, where he administered minimally invasive cosmetic medical treatments.

Van Camp is an adjunct professor at Washburn University and the University of Kansas, and participates in clinical and scientific medical research. He serves as the Medical Director of Precise Clinical Research.
